An Associated Press videographer saw the wrecked hospital in Petionville, a hillside Port-au-Prince district that is home to many diplomats and wealthy Haitians, as well as many poor people. Elsewhere in the capital, U.S. government official reported seeing houses that had tumbled into a ravine.


The earthquake had a preliminary magnitude of 7.0 and was centered about 10 miles (15 kilometers) west of Port-au-Prince at a depth of 5 miles (8 kilometers), the U.S. Geological Survey said. Kristin Marano USGS geophysicist called it the strongest earthquake since 1770 in what is now Haiti. In 1946, a magnitude-8.1 quake struck the Dominican Republic and Haiti also shook, producing a tsunami that killed 1.790 people.

Tuesday’s quake was felt in the Dominican Republic, Which shares a border with Haiti on the island of Hispaniola, and some panicked residents in the capital of Santo Domingo Fled from their homes shaking. But no major damage was reported there.
